What is a Google Workspace add-on?

A Google Workspace add-on is a small application that installs from the Google Workspace Marketplace and runs natively inside Google Drive, Gmail, Docs, Sheets, Slides or Calendar. Unlike a standalone SaaS tool, an add-on lives in the Workspace side panel — so your team never leaves Google to use it, and your data never leaves Google's runtime.

How is Soluvery different from native Google Workspace admin tools?

Google's native Admin console is excellent at policy and provisioning, but thin on day-to-day workflows — bulk Drive permission cleanup, scheduled external-sharing reports, rule-based outbound email approvals, ownership transfer at scale, and Shared Drive migration are either missing or require custom Apps Script. Workspace glossary

Speak Workspace, fluently

Google Workspace add-on
A Marketplace-distributed application that runs natively inside Drive, Gmail, Docs, Sheets, Slides or Calendar via the Workspace side panel.
CASA certification
Google's Cloud Application Security Assessment — an independent third-party security audit required for Workspace Marketplace apps that access sensitive scopes.
OAuth scope
The specific Google API permissions an add-on requests at install time. Soluvery uses the minimum scopes required per feature.
Shared Drive
A Google Drive folder owned by a team rather than an individual. Shared Drives survive employee offboarding; My Drive does not.
Workspace Marketplace
Google's official catalog of vetted third-party apps and add-ons that integrate with Google Workspace.
External sharing
Any Drive permission granted to a user outside your Workspace domain — the single largest source of accidental data exposure.
